The management at BuyRite grocery stores wishes to estimate the amount of time that customers are spending, on average, in its stores and in a checkout line. The most obvious approach for determining this information is to simply record when a customer enters and exits the store. However, it is difficult to track the entering and exiting times of specific customers. We will look at the problem using an alternative approach. Over the past two weeks, the following data have been collected at BuyRite’s newest store during busy hours (this BuyRite is rather large and typically has 7 open checkout lines). For simplicity, let us assume that the overall capacity at checkout lines is higher than the arrival rate of customers into the store.
Average rate of customers entering store = 305 customers/hour
Average number of customers in store = 146 customers
Percentage of customers who do not make a purchase = 5%
Average number of customers in the checkout lines = 24 customers
As their consultant, you have been asked by BuyRite’s management to address the following questions:
(a) How much time on average does a customer spend in the store?
(b) How much time on average does a customer spend waiting?

Answer :

Answer and Explanation:

a. The computation of the time on an average that customer spend in the store is given below:

As we know that

Average number of Customers = Average rate of Customers Entered × Average time spend  

So, Average time spend = Average number of Customers  ÷ Average rate of Customers Entered

 = 146 ÷ 305

= 0.478689 Hours

Now

= 0.478689 × 60

= 28.72 minutes

b. The computation of the time on an average the customer spend waiting is given below:

We know that

The Average number of Customers in waiting = Average rate of Customers Entered × Average time spend by customer for waiting in checkout lines

 Average time spend by customer for waiting in checkout lines = Average number of Customers in waiting ÷ Average rate of Customers entered

= 24 ÷ 305

= 0.078689 hours

Now

= 0.078689 ×  60

= 4.72 minutes
